K1 SE (open frame K1C) with CFS. Works perfectly. I primarily use the RFID Creality Hyper PLA with it though. But I have run generic PLA and PETG with it fine.

Congrats!I'll try to help, but will answer the first question last. Its wordy Do I need to enclose it for CF? Nope. PLA-CF is a low warp material, like PLA.
